Buwaya are saurians from Tagalog folklore. They live in deep-sea caves and have a coffin-like saddle growing on their backs. When a Buwaya captures a human, it locks the victim inside the saddle to carry them down to their underwater lairs. To the ancient Tagalogs, the Buwaya were considered sacred beings. The act of killing a Buwaya was punishable by death.
